VM Ubuntu + drupal8 + drush = помилка drush en module_name -y


0

Я встановив Ubuntu VirtualBox:

Пам'ять Ubuntu 16.04 LTS: 3,9 Gio Тип операційної системи: 64-бітний диск: 101,3 ГБ

Я хочу створити сайт Drupal 8 за допомогою platform.sh

Тому я встановлюю composer, unzip, git, drushі platformчерез Убунту термінал.

Все це добре працює.

Але я зіткнувся з помилкою, коли хочу завантажити та активувати модуль drupal через drush.

Я використовую таку команду:

Drush en module_name -y

У мене є така помилка:

Command pm-enable needs a higher bootstrap level to run - 
you will need to invoke drush from a more functional Drupal environment to run this command.
The drush command 'in module_name' coulld not be executed.

Те саме і з командою sudo. І те саме з drush dl + drush en.

Я шукав в Інтернеті і бачу, що деякі люди рекомендують змінити localhost setting.phpна 127.0.0.1.

Однак у моїй папці, створеній через платформу, у мене немає стандартного setting.phpфайлу, і я не бачу або як змінити localhost / 127.0.0.1

Я новачок в ubuntu і не можу цього зробити :(

Чи може хтось мені допомогти / порадити рішення?

Дякую :)

Відповіді:


0

Я спробував встановити модуль з drush + CLI Platform:

MyName@MyName-VirtualBox: ~ / Documents / MySite/ web / sites / default $ platform drush ' 
Directory / app / web / modules / contrib exists, but is not writable. Please [error] 
Check directory permissions. 
Project colorbox (8.x-1.2) could not be downloaded to [error] 
/ App / web // modules / contrib / colorbox

І все-таки моя папка contrib налаштована на читання та запис для всіх.

Як ми можемо перевірити, що це так? (командний рядок?) І якщо ні, то як налаштувати ці дозволи?

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.